The new io_uring_register(2) IOURING_REGISTER_RESTRICTIONS opcode
permanently installs a feature allowlist on an io_ring_ctx.
The io_ring_ctx can then be passed to untrusted code with the
knowledge that only operations present in the allowlist can be
executed.

The allowlist approach ensures that new features added to io_uring
do not accidentally become available when an existing application
is launched on a newer kernel version.

Currently is it possible to restrict sqe opcodes and register
opcodes. It is also possible to allow only fixed files.

IOURING_REGISTER_RESTRICTIONS can only be made once. Afterwards
it is not possible to change restrictions anymore.
This prevents untrusted code from removing restrictions.

Not sure I totally love this API. Maybe it'd be cleaner to have separate
ops for this, instead of muxing it like this. One for registering op
code restrictions, and one for disallowing other parts (like fixed
files, etc).

I think that would look a lot cleaner than the above.

My concerns are largely:

1) An API that's straight forward to use
2) Something that'll work with future changes

The "allow these opcodes" is straightforward, and ditto for the register
opcodes. The fixed file I guess is the odd one out. So if we need to
disallow things in the future, we'll need to add a new restriction
sub-op. Should this perhaps be "these flags must be set", and that could
easily be augmented with "these flags must not be set"?

You're right. I e-mailed about that whit Kees Cook [1] and he agreed that the
restrictions in io_uring should allow us to address some issues that with
seccomp it's a bit difficult. For example:
- different restrictions for different io_uring instances in the same
  process
- limit SQEs to use only registered fds and buffers

Maybe seccomp could take advantage of the restrictions to filter SQEs opcodes.

Okay, now I get it, and I think that's a good point. I'm going to change that
to restrict SQE flags.

About the registration of restrictions, what do you think is the best solution
among them?
1. a single register op (e.g. IORING_REGISTER_RESTRICTIONS) which has an array
   of restrictions as a parameter.
2. a register op for each restriction (sqe ops, register ops, sqe flags, etc.),
   that requires multiple io_uring_register() calls to register all the
   restrictions.

I'd go for the first one (basically as it's implemented in this RFC) because
it seems more extensible and manageable to me, but I'd like to have your
opinion.
